Online Loan Regulations in Ontario
Ontario regulates payday and short-term loans to protect consumers. Key points from Ontario.ca:
- Maximum cost is $15 per $100 borrowed.
- Loan term must be at least 62 days if it’s $1,500 or less.
- Lenders must be licensed with the province.
